Subject: [PATCH] devfreq: tegra20: add COMMON_CLK dependency
Date: Fri, 28 Jun 2019 12:32:20 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190628103232.2467959-1-arnd@arndb.de> (raw)

Compile-testing the new driver on platforms without CONFIG_COMMON_CLK
leads to a link error:

drivers/devfreq/tegra20-devfreq.o: In function `tegra_devfreq_target':
tegra20-devfreq.c:(.text+0x288): undefined reference to `clk_set_min_rate'

Add a dependency on COMMON_CLK to avoid this.

Fixes: 1d39ee8dad6d ("PM / devfreq: Introduce driver for NVIDIA Tegra20")
Signed-off-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de>
---
 drivers/devfreq/Kconfig | 1 +
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)

diff --git a/drivers/devfreq/Kconfig b/drivers/devfreq/Kconfig
index f3b242987fd9..defe1d438710 100644
--- a/drivers/devfreq/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/devfreq/Kconfig
@@ -107,6 +107,7 @@ config ARM_TEGRA_DEVFREQ
 config ARM_TEGRA20_DEVFREQ
 	tristate "NVIDIA Tegra20 DEVFREQ Driver"
 	depends on (TEGRA_MC && TEGRA20_EMC) || COMPILE_TEST
+	depends on COMMON_CLK
 	select DEVFREQ_GOV_SIMPLE_ONDEMAND
 	select PM_OPP
 	help
